Across TCGA cell cohorts, PTPRB RNA expression is significantly associated with the RNA expression of many other genes, with 7,774 significant associations in total. SOFT_TISSUE sh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ible PTPRB-associated genes across cancer lineages are PTPRR, LOX, and IL7R. Each is linked with PTPRB in more than 13 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both PTPRB-to-partner and partner-to-PTPRB results are reported.
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est example, PTPRB versus PTPRR in SOFT_TISSUE, with a Pearson correlation of 0.78.
